Salespeak runs roughly 1,000 conversations per week. Converra improved the orchestrator agent that routes conversations to the right specialist, then verified the result in production.

Mis-routed queries dropped from 16% to 5% of production traffic after Apr 25 deploy. Verified.
Converra generated and tested the fixes; Salespeak's CTO reviewed and applied the winning changes.
The orchestrator sits at the front of the agent system. When it routes incorrectly, users land with the wrong specialist, get dismissed, or receive unsupported product claims. Fixing that layer improves the whole downstream experience.
Converra analyzed production conversations from the router that decides which specialist agent should handle each user.
The fixes focused on routing behavior and hallucinated claims instead of generic prompt rewriting.
Variants were evaluated against realistic multi-turn conversations before any change touched production.
Results were measured from post-deploy live traffic for each target failure mode.
Converra is not just reporting on agent failures. It closes the loop from diagnosed production issue to generated fix, simulated validation, deployment, and measured production outcome.
